## Overview
Flow is a fundamental concept in dynamical systems theory, providing tools for understanding the qualitative behavior of differential equations and flows on manifolds.
## Mathematical Definition
```
FLOW: Phase space × Time → Phase space
```
## Key Properties
1. **Local behavior**: Analysis near equilibria and invariant sets
2. **Global structure**: Long-term dynamics and limit sets
3. **Bifurcations**: Parameter-dependent qualitative changes
4. **Stability**: Robustness under perturbation
